A town centre in Conwy could lose its hanging baskets amid health and safety fears over watering them. | A town centre in Conwy could lose its hanging baskets amid health and safety fears over watering them. |
Abergele town council said traders wanted to withdraw council-funded baskets outside shops because staff could be injured trying to reach them. | Abergele town council said traders wanted to withdraw council-funded baskets outside shops because staff could be injured trying to reach them. |
Councillor Richard Waters said the baskets were a popular feature and it would be "unfortunate" to lose them. | Councillor Richard Waters said the baskets were a popular feature and it would be "unfortunate" to lose them. |
The Abergele Association of Traders said health and safety was a concern, but no decision had yet been made. | The Abergele Association of Traders said health and safety was a concern, but no decision had yet been made. |
Councillor Waters said: "The baskets have been in the town for two or three years and they have been very popular with visitors and residents. | Councillor Waters said: "The baskets have been in the town for two or three years and they have been very popular with visitors and residents. |
"They are a very attractive feature, but I understand some traders are worried about health and safety issues when people are having to reach above head height, or climb up to water them. | "They are a very attractive feature, but I understand some traders are worried about health and safety issues when people are having to reach above head height, or climb up to water them. |
"But, if that is the only issue, then there are watering systems available that can be installed to make sure people don't have to reach up high. | "But, if that is the only issue, then there are watering systems available that can be installed to make sure people don't have to reach up high. |
"There is £750 set aside in the budget for these hanging baskets, and if the traders don't want to participate, the money will be spent elsewhere, perhaps on flower borders." | |
Jeanette Dew, of the Abergele Association of Traders, confirmed health and safety was "an issue", but declined to comment further. | Jeanette Dew, of the Abergele Association of Traders, confirmed health and safety was "an issue", but declined to comment further. |
